The infrastructure landscape of New York State presents one of the world's most demanding operating environments for road construction and pavement maintenance machinery. Spanning dense metropolitan arterial networks like NYC’s I-278 (Brooklyn-Queens Expressway) and the Long Island Expressway (I-495) to northern interstate corridors like I-87 (Thruway) and I-90, pavement structures endure extreme mechanical shear, high annual average daily traffic (AADT) loads exceeding 200,000 vehicles per day, and aggressive freeze-thaw thermal cycling.
Under the administration of the New York State Department of Transportation (NYSDOT) and municipal bodies like the NYC Department of Transportation (NYCDOT), paving contractors operate under strict operational windows, stringent noise emissions criteria, and rigorous material compaction metrics. Navigating these requirements demands next-generation machinery that combines high thermal-retention asphalt distribution, micro-processor-controlled dynamic compaction, and zero-loss cold-in-place recycling capabilities.
New York's climate is characterized by severe winter conditions, heavy salt application (sodium chloride and magnesium chloride brine treatments), and significant temperature fluctuations ranging from sub-zero winter blasts to summer surface temperatures topping 140°F (60°C). This severe thermal expansion and contraction triggers premature micro-cracking, stripping, and deep-pavement rutting.
To withstand these conditions, modern NY infrastructure relies heavily on Polymer-Modified Asphalt (PMA) and stone matrix asphalt (SMA) mixtures requiring precise layup thermal management. Standard paving equipment often suffers from thermal segregation, leading to localized pavement densities below the critical 92% Maximum Theoretical Density (MTD) threshold. Traditional full-depth asphalt reclamation involves massive logistics overhead, aggregate hauling emissions, and extended lane closure durations—factors that are unacceptable in high-density NY traffic zones. Our Cold In-Place Recycler (CIPR) train solutions pulverize damaged asphalt layers, introduce calibrated foamed bitumen or asphalt emulsion, mix in precise cement ratios, and re-lay a stabilized base layer in a single continuous pass.
By utilizing 100% Reclaimed Asphalt Pavement (RAP), NY municipalities reduce carbon footprints by up to 45%, lower virgin aggregate trucking cycles by 75%, and cut project timelines by over 30%. Bond-coat integrity is critical to preventing delamination between structural pavement lifts. HEM Group’s Intelligent Bitumen Distributors incorporate dual-stage heating systems with automatic computer-controlled spray bars. Using radar-based velocity sensors, the machine dynamically adjusts nozzle delivery rates to match ground speed precisely down to ±1% variation.
Whether applying SBS-modified asphalt binder or high-float emulsion tack coats, our equipment guarantees uniform spray distribution across variable widths, preventing bleeding, slippage failures, and fat spots under heavy traffic loading.
